Critical Reloading Equipment: A Newbie's Guide
For newbie reloaders, deciding on the ideal tools can appear overpowering, but beginning with the basic principles ensures a sleek Understanding curve. The very first essential Resource is a high quality reloading press, which delivers The steadiness essential for precise cartridge assembly. Simple one-stage presses are best for beginners since they simplify the process and reduce complexity, enabling you to center on mastering Each and every stage with treatment. Alongside a push, a list of reloading dies precise on your calibers is necessary for resizing and seating bullets.
One more significant piece of reloading devices is a trusted powder scale or measure, which assures regular powder prices for each cartridge—a important factor in protection and performance. Furthermore, a situation trimmer, chamfering equipment, and primer pocket cleaners enable manage consistent case Proportions, ensuring round precision and proper chamber match. Like a starter, buying a reloading handbook is important; it provides crucial knowledge, security pointers, and move-by-move Guidance to help make your reloading practical experience both of those Secure and gratifying. Reloading Push Forms: Deciding on the Suitable Just one for Your preferences
The sort of reloading press you select profoundly impacts your workflow, output velocity, and also the complexity of duties you may accomplish. One-stage presses are the most easy and economical choices, ideal for beginners or People specializing in precision loads, as they permit very careful Regulate over Just about every phase and minimal setup time. Their simplicity usually means much less going components, fostering a safer environment for Discovering and experimentation.
Progressive presses, Alternatively, are made for significant-volume reloading and have many stations that complete distinct duties simultaneously—including resizing, priming, powder charging, and seating. This significantly decreases generation time, generating them well suited for reloaders who require massive quantities immediately. Turret presses occupy a middle floor; they offer multi-station capabilities but with the pliability of switching dies for different calibers or responsibilities. In the long run, your choice is dependent upon your reloading objectives, volume demands, Place criteria, and spending plan. For hobbyists or All those mastering specific calibers, a single-stage press gives Manage; for aggressive shooters or hunters producing significant batches, a progressive press gives the effectiveness wanted.
